So anyways i have a Casio CTK-491 MIDI keyboard hooked into a Tascam US-200 MIDI/Audio Interface,which goes into a Toshiba C655D Laptop(running Windows 7 64 bit) via a USB connection.The Casio is wired to the interface with a standart MIDI cable and it goes from Casio's MIDI OUT to Tascam's MIDI IN... The software that i use is mainly Reason 5,but this problem is exactly the same with every other software(FL Studio for example). So basically i hook up my MIDI keyboard and everything i power it up and start working on a track and everything works fine for about 10 minutes or so....after that everything goes crazy-notes start turning on/off really fast by theirself. I just want to state that i am a musician and i have absolutely no idea how to program midi and such... Anyways so i started MIDI-OX and monitored what's going on upon input.And as said before everything works fine and when suddenly the whole thing bugs out it either gives me a C-0 Note Off spam non-stop,a C-0 Key Aftertouch Spam,or some strange Pitch Bend and my keyboard doesn't even have a Pitch Bend wheel.... Title: Re: MIDI keyboard acting weird(need urgent help,pl Post by Breath on Oct 10th, 2013, 6:10pm I have only 2 suggestions. The first is that your Midi cable from the Casio out is faulty. Try swapping it with another cable. As it happens after some time it is more likely that there is a problem with the Casio. My first guess is that the Midi Out socket on the inside needs re-soldering, but it could be a worse problem. Grab the plug at the Casio end of the Midi cable (while plugged in) and give it a gentle wiggle. If the problem starts when you wiggle it then the socket inside the Casio is likely to be the problem. Try another keyboard if you have one, to see if it is in fact the Casio. All the best Royce |

Title: Re: MIDI keyboard acting weird(need urgent help,pl Post by Hustle056 on Oct 11th, 2013, 6:06pm Turns out it was a faulty MIDI cable ;D I did a bit of testing last night and it seems to be working good now it worked atleast 30 minutes without any problem :D |
